Hyperbaric Chamber Tender / Operator Course
For some divers working the dry-side is more appealing as a dive career than diving itself. All commercial operations require hyperbaric recompression chamber operators and tenders - it is a diving career in it's own right.. *Coming in 2007* - The Hyperbaric Chamber Tender / Operator course The Hyper baric Chamber course is 5 days in length. Students will also learn the duties of the INSIDE Tender. The Tender is the person who will set up the "Inside" of the chamber and also take care of the chamber after the treatment. Students wishing to be a Recompression Chamber Operator/Tender do not necessarily have to be scuba divers. Students should have some type of CPR and Rescue training prior to taking the Chamber course.
